What a fantastic way to kick off National Carers Week! On Saturday, nearly 2,000 people – carers and their families – joined us for our Carer Gateway Family Day at Grazeland. We had an amazing time celebrating Victorian carers with multicultural dance performances, high-flying stilt walkers, live music and endless food stalls. Carers are the unsung heroes of our community and this was the perfect way to honour their hard work and dedication.

The feedback from the event was phenomenal, with one carer sharing “Had a ball! Thank you so much to the team and everyone involved!”
Adam Demirtel, Holstep Health’s Director of Carers, commented, “We came together to honour the commitment, sacrifices, and the incredible work carers do every single day. Most importantly, it was an opportunity for carers to enjoy themselves and take some well-deserved time for fun and connection.”
